LAFAYETTE, La. (KADN) — Teams of volunteers with Parish Proud and the University of Louisiana are cleaning up what's left behind after Carnival Season, including more than 30,000 pounds of trash from Mardi Gras. Now that the festivities of Carnival Season are over, 160 volunteers with Krewe de Coulee showed up to pick trash and beads along the parade route.

LAFAYETTE, La. (KADN) — The all-clear was given in downtown Lafayette where a bomb threat forced the evacuation of all three courthouses for hours. Authorities scoured the trio of buildings looking for explosives on Wednesday, March 27, but ultimately, none were found.
